In the rapidly evolving world of display technology, strip screen series have emerged as a critical solution for industrial, commercial, and consumer applications. These screens—ranging from compact 14.1-inch models to massive 86-inch panels—are engineered for flexibility, clarity, and durability in diverse environments. The strip screen series includes widely used sizes such as 19", 19.5", 21.2", 23.1", 24", 28", 28.6", 29", 29.4", 36.6", 37", 37.6", 42", 43", 48.3", 48.5", 49.3", 49.5", 56.6", 58.4", 58.6", and up to 86" diagonal measurements. Each size serves a specific market need—from embedded systems and medical equipment (e.g., 14.1" and 19") to digital signage, kiosks, and large-scale control rooms (e.g., 58.6" and 86").
Manufacturers like LG, Sharp, and AU Optronics design these displays using advanced LCD technologies such as IPS, TN, and VA panels, offering wide viewing angles, high contrast ratios, and low power consumption. For example, the 21.2" and 23.1" strips are commonly found in industrial PCs due to their balance of resolution (typically 1080p or higher) and ruggedized housings that support -30°C to +70°C operating temperatures. Meanwhile, the 48.5" and 58.6" models are often deployed in retail and public transportation settings, where large-format visibility and touch compatibility are essential.
Environmental resilience is another key feature—many strip screens are certified to IP65 standards for dust and water resistance, making them suitable for outdoor use. Industry reports from MarketsandMarkets and Grand View Research confirm that demand for custom-sized strip screens has grown by over 12% annually since 2022, driven by smart manufacturing, IoT integration, and the rise of edge computing. Customers increasingly prioritize modular designs that allow easy replacement or scaling within existing infrastructure, particularly in automation and logistics sectors.
For system integrators and OEMs, choosing the right strip screen size depends on application-specific parameters like mounting space, brightness requirements (often >300 nits), and input interface options (HDMI, LVDS, MIPI). Rigorous testing per IEC 60068-2 standards ensures reliability under vibration, shock, and thermal cycling.
